And no, one can’t (usually) judge what type of emitter it is just by the light itself.

But you CAN judge what type of emitter it is by inspecting the emitters directly.
And the emitters in this light is NOT Cree XP-L emitters as advertised.

The emitters in this light differ from real XP-L’s:
-XP-L’s have domes that completely cover the die size.
-XP-L domes are also vertically cut on all four sides, making them not completely round.

I think chances are good if you’re persistent.
First contact the seller (paypal likes to see that you tried to work it out) provide pictures of your light, closeup of the led and a real cree for comparison. Tell them what you expect as a resolution. Write simply and stick to the main points. When they insist it’s real or offer anything short of a full refund just repeat that the LEDs are “counterfeit” and that you will only accept a full refund.
Presuming they don’t give you a full refund, open a paypal dispute and forward them the messages you’ve had with the seller.

If your submission is approved by PP, you get a full refund, then, I believe, PP will try to recover funds from the vendor. I think it's been reported here in the past that PP will only do this a limited amount of times for you, maybe so many per month or year, etc. The vendor can be at risk for losing their PP account if PP gets a lot of these disputes coming in from the same vendor.

GOt my 7*“XP-L” Version today.

Built quality seems fine.
The LEDs sit on a alu-plate,2mm thick with a thread on the outside - but the host doesn’t have a thread.
So the whole screwed-together Reflector, LEDs and Plate come out, if you unscrew the bezel.
Then you can see the worlds thinest wires - seriouyls, I never saw anything thin like that.

The light output is a joke - but the host is rather nice. Because of the missing threads inside, it’s easy to make a fitting pill and mod the sh*t out of it.
